It is connected to the sentence\u2019s adjective or adverb. The listing of an adjective or adverb\u2019s positive, comparative, and superlative forms is what the Collins Dictionary refers to as the \u201cdegree of comparison.\u201d In other words, it can be claimed that one can compare nouns that have similar properties or attributes using the degree of comparison.<\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Degrees_of_Comparison_Types\"><\/span><strong>Degrees of Comparison Types<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p>There are three types of degrees of comparison named: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Positive degree of comparison.<\/li>\n<li>Comparative degree of comparison.<\/li>\n<li>Superlative degree of comparison.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><strong>Positive Degree of the Adjective<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p>The primary form of the adjective is called the positive degree. It is the adjective itself. For example,<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Ron is\u00a0tall.<\/li>\n<li>The bridge is\u00a0long.<\/li>\n<li>Michael is a\u00a0bad<\/li>\n<li>Monica is\u00a0studious.<\/li>\n<li>The scenery of\u00a0beautiful.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><strong>Comparative Degree of the Adjective<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p>The comparative degree of the adjective is used when two persons or things are compared. To change the positive degree into comparative, the adjective is adjoined with \u2018er\u2019 or \u2018more\u2019. If we take the previous examples into consideration, they are written in the comparative degree as follows: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Ron is\u00a0taller than Donald.<\/li>\n<li>The Howrah bridge is\u00a0longer than the Victoria bridge.<\/li>\n<li>Michael is\u00a0worse than Adam.<\/li>\n<li>Monica is\u00a0more studious than Mary.<\/li>\n<li>The scenery in this room is\u00a0more beautiful than the one in that room.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><strong>Superlative Degree of the Adjective<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p>When comparing three or more nouns or subjects, the superlative degree is used in the sentence. Let us, again, take the above three adjectives and write them in the superlative degree. They can be written as follows: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Ron is the\u00a0tallest person in the room.<\/li>\n<li>The Howrah bridge is the\u00a0longest bridge in the world.<\/li>\n<li>Michael is the\u00a0worst person I\u2019ve seen.<\/li>\n<li>Monica is the\u00a0most studious student in the room.<\/li>\n<li>That scenery is the\u00a0most beautiful scenery of all.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p style=\"text-align: center;\"><a href=\"https:\/\/entri.app\/course\/spoken-english-course\/\"><span data-sheets-value=\"{&quot;1&quot;:2,&quot;2&quot;:&quot;Elevate your speaking skills with our Spoken English Course!&quot;}\" data-sheets-userformat=\"{&quot;2&quot;:8705,&quot;3&quot;:{&quot;1&quot;:0},&quot;12&quot;:0,&quot;16&quot;:10}\">Elevate your speaking skills with our Spoken English Course!<\/span><\/a><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Forming_the_Comparative_and_Superlative_Degrees\"><\/span><strong>Forming the Comparative and Superlative Degrees<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p>Here are the rules for forming the comparative and superlative degrees of adjectives:<\/p>\n<table>\n<tbody>\n<tr>\n<th>Type of Adjective<\/th>\n<th>Example in the Positive Degree<\/th>\n<th>How to Form the Comparative Degree<\/th>\n<th>How to Form the Superlative Degree<\/th>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>one syllable<\/td>\n<td>\n<ul>\n<li>strong<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>add\u00a0<i>er<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>stronger<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>add\u00a0<i>est<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>strongest<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>one syllable ending vowel consonant<\/td>\n<td>\n<ul>\n<li>thin<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>double consonant and add\u00a0<i>er<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>thinner<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>double consonant and add\u00a0<i>est<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>thinnest<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>more than one syllable<\/td>\n<td>\n<ul>\n<li>famous<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>add\u00a0<i>less<\/i>\u00a0or\u00a0<i>more<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>more famous<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>add\u00a0<i>most<\/i>\u00a0or\u00a0<i>least<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>least famous<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>more than one syllable ending y<\/td>\n<td>\n<ul>\n<li>silly<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>remove\u00a0<i>y<\/i>\u00a0add\u00a0<i>ier<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>sillier<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><b>for less<\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>less silly<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>remove\u00a0<i>y<\/i>\u00a0add\u00a0<i>iest<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>silliest<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><b>for least<\/b><br \/>\nleast silly<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>irregular<\/td>\n<td>\n<ul>\n<li>bad<\/li>\n<li>good<\/li>\n<li>many<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>no rules<\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>worse<\/li>\n<li>better<\/li>\n<li>more<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>no rules<\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>worst<\/li>\n<li>best<\/li>\n<li>most<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<\/tbody>\n<\/table>\n<p>Here are the rules for forming the comparative and superlative degrees of adverbs:<\/p>\n<table>\n<tbody>\n<tr>\n<th>Type of Adverb<\/th>\n<th>Example in the Positive Degree<\/th>\n<th>How to Form the Comparative<\/th>\n<th>How to Form the Superlative<\/th>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>one syllable<\/td>\n<td>\n<ul>\n<li>fast<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>add\u00a0<i>er<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>faster<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>add\u00a0<i>est<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>fastest<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>more than one syllable<\/td>\n<td>\n<ul>\n<li>carefully<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>add\u00a0<i>less<\/i>\u00a0or\u00a0<i>more<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>more carefully<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>add\u00a0<i>most<\/i>\u00a0or\u00a0<i>least<\/i><\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>most carefully<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>irregular<\/td>\n<td>\n<ul>\n<li>badly<\/li>\n<li>well<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>no rules<\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>worse<\/li>\n<li>better<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<td><b>no rules<\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>worst<\/li>\n<li>best<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<\/tbody>\n<\/table>\n<div id=\"Degree-Of-Comparison-Rules\">\n<p style=\"text-align: center;\"><a href=\"https:\/\/entri.app\/course\/spoken-english-course\/\"><span data-sheets-value=\"{&quot;1&quot;:2,&quot;2&quot;:&quot;Speak confidently and fluently with our Spoken English Course!&quot;}\" data-sheets-userformat=\"{&quot;2&quot;:8705,&quot;3&quot;:{&quot;1&quot;:0},&quot;12&quot;:0,&quot;16&quot;:10}\">Speak confidently and fluently with our Spoken English Course!<\/span><\/a><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Degree_Of_Comparison_Rules\"><\/span><strong>Degree Of Comparison Rules<\/strong><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<\/div>\n<p><b>Rule 1.\u00a0<\/b>When two items\/people are compared, a comparative degree is used by putting \u2018er\u2019 to the adjective word in association with the word \u2018than\u2019. In some cases \u2018more\u2019 is used.<\/p>\n<p>Comparative degree example: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>She is\u00a0smarter than\u00a0her sister.<\/li>\n<li>She is\u00a0more cheerful than\u00a0her sister.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Similarly, when more than two things\/people are compared, the superlative degree is used by putting \u2018est\u2019 to the adjective word or in some cases \u2018most\u2019 is used.<\/p>\n<p>Superlative degree of comparison examples: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>He is the\u00a0strongest\u00a0wrestler.<\/li>\n<li>He is the\u00a0most handsome\u00a0actor.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><b>Rule 2.<\/b>\u00a0\u2018More\u2019 is used when you compare qualities of a single thing\/person. Even if the first adjective is a single syllable word.<\/p>\n<p>Degree of comparison examples:<\/p>\n<p>Incorrect \u2013 She is smarter than clever.<\/p>\n<p>Correct \u2013 She is more smart than clever.<\/p>\n<p><b>Rule 3.\u00a0<\/b>Do not use double comparative adjectives or superlative adjectives.<\/p>\n<p>Degree of comparison examples:<\/p>\n<p>Incorrect \u2013 These mangoes are more tastier than those.<\/p>\n<p>Correct \u2013 These mangoes are tastier than those.<\/p>\n<p><b>Rule 4.\u00a0<\/b>Never use \u2018more or most\u2019 with adjectives that give absolute sense.<\/p>\n<p>Degree of comparison example:<\/p>\n<p>Incorrect \u2013 This track is more parallel to that one<\/p>\n<p>Correct \u2013 This track is parallel and the other is not.<\/p>\n<p><b>Rule 5.\u00a0<\/b>There are a few adjectives that are accompanied by \u2018to\u2019, like, senior, junior, superior, inferior, preferable,\u00a0 prefer, elder. Do not use \u2018than\u2019 with these adjectives.<\/p>\n<p>Degree of adjective examples:<\/p>\n<p>Incorrect: I am elder than her.<\/p>\n<p>Correct: I am elder to her.<\/p>\n<p>Incorrect \u2013 This car brand is superior than that.<\/p>\n<p>Correct \u2013 This card brand is superior to that.<\/p>\n<p><b>Rule 6.\u00a0<\/b>When comparing two things, similarity should be there, i.e. similar things should be compared.<\/p>\n<p>Examples of degree of comparison:<\/p>\n<p>Incorrect \u2013 This wall colour is more beautiful than the old one. (wall colour is compared with the wall)<\/p>\n<p>Correct\u00a0 \u2013 This wall colour is more beautiful than that of the old one. (compare wall colour with wall colour)<\/p>\n<p><b>Rule 7.\u00a0<\/b>When the comparative degree is used in the superlative degree sense<\/p>\n<ol>\n<li>Use \u2018any other\u2019 when thing\/person of the same group is compared.<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p>Degree of comparison example:<\/p>\n<p>Incorrect: Reena is smarter than any student of her class.<\/p>\n<p>Correct: Reena is smarter than\u00a0any other\u00a0student of her class.<\/p>\n<ol>\n<li>Use \u2018any\u2019 if comparison of things\/person is outside the group.<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p>Incorrect: Delhi is cleaner than any other city in Bangladesh.<\/p>\n<p>Correct: Delhi is cleaner than\u00a0any\u00a0city in Bangladesh.<\/p>\n<p><b>Rule 8.\u00a0<\/b>When in the same sentence two adjectives in different degrees of comparison are used, both should be complete in themselves.<\/p>\n<p>Incorrect- She is as good if not worse than her sister.<\/p>\n<p>Correct \u2013 She is as good as if not worse than her sister.<\/p>\n<p><b>Rule 9.\u00a0<\/b>To show whether the difference between the compared thing\/person is small or big, we use quantifiers for the comparative degree of an adjective such as (A bit, a little, a lot, far, much, a great deal, significantly, etc).<\/p>\n<p><strong>Example: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>My hostel is only\u00a0marginally\u00a0bigger than yours.<\/li>\n<li>She is\u00a0a little\u00a0more popular than her sister in their school.<\/li>\n<li>Australia is\u00a0slightly\u00a0smaller than Africa.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>We don\u2019t use quantifiers with superlative degrees of adjectives but there are certain phrases commonly used with the superlative degrees of comparison.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Degree of Comparison Example: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>In metropolitan cities, metros are\u00a0by far the\u00a0cheapest mode of transportation.<\/li>\n<li>Sanskrit is\u00a0one of the\u00a0oldest languages in the world.<\/li>\n<li>Siddhivinayak is\u00a0the second\u00a0richest temple in India.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><b>Rule. 10.\u00a0<\/b>While changing the degree of comparison for the irregular adjectives, the word completely changes instead of adding \u2018er\u2019 or \u2018est\u2019.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Examples:<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>She has\u00a0little\u00a0milk in the jar.<\/li>\n<li>She has\u00a0less\u00a0milk than he has.<\/li>\n<li>She has the\u00a0least
